Southbrook Vineyards
Southbrook Vineyards

Southbrook Vineyards in the Niagara-on-the-Lake region of Ontario undertakes biodynamic and organic vineyard agriculture, plus is LEED Gold Certified for their energy and environmental design in green buildings.  Southbrook is Canada’s first certified Organic and Biodynamic Winery.  They have everything from native meadows and a Monarch butterfly waystation to using lighter wine bottles to lower their carbon footprint.  I looked forward to this visit based on their environmentally conscious efforts in the vineyards and in the winery.  I met with Casey Hogan, their winemaker, who led me through an extensive list of their wines. Casey has worked with wineries in Margaret River, Central Otago, Willamette Valley, the Okanagan Valley (CedarCreek), and Niagara.  

Most of their grapes come from their estate vineyard but they do have contracts with some organic grape growers. All wines are wild fermented, but if there is an issue with the fermentation, then some organic yeast can be added.  The reds get 18 months of oak aging. Now, let’s get into the wines.

My Wine Tasting Notes

Southbrook Vineyards Triomphe Riesling 2021 – Triomphe is their introductory tier of wines with the fruit coming from several organic vineyards. Stainless steel fermented.  This wine has a bright medium-intensity lemon colour. Nice aromas, medium intensity, of lemon, stone fruits and petrol. Dryish, medium body with a lean mouthfeel. Astringent mouthfeel with medium-plus acidity. Tart citrus, lime and lime peel flavours. Medium plus length. 4 stars

Southbrook Vineyards Triomphe Chardonnay 2019 – 2019 is the first vintage for Casey at Southbrook.  This wine is 100% barrel-fermented Chardonnay in a mix of new and old French oak. Casey likes to use barrels with a medium toast.  This wine has a medium-intensity lemon colour. Medium-intensity nose showing pears, melon and a touch of citrus. This wine is dry, medium-plus body with a smooth soft, thick mouthfeel. Melon and pears plus a touch of vanilla on the palate. Tart fruit and touches of oak and sweet spices on the finish. 4 stars

Southbrook Vineyards Saunders Family Vineyard Chardonnay 2020 – Also barrel fermented.  2020 was a warmer vintage.  This wine has a lighter lemon colour. Light toasty nose with touches of roasted apples. Medium-plus body with a round smooth mouthfeel. Dry, medium-plus acidity but not too strong. Light toast and apple flavours integrated well together. 4 stars4.5 stars

Southbrook Vineyards Whimsy Amphora Chardonnay 2021 – Whimsy are one-off bottles that they produce in a year.  This wine is fermented and aged in amphora.  It has a bright, medium-plus intensity lemon colour. Medium-minus ripe pear aromas. Medium body, smooth with a round and a little thicker mouthfeel. Nice textured mouthfeel. Medium plus acidity and medium length. Some tartness through to the finish. 4 stars4.5 stars

Southbrook Vineyards Triomphe Skin Fermented White 2021 – a blend of Chardonnay Musque and Vidal grapes. It is fermented in a mix of stainless and oak vats.  Pressed and settled in stainless tanks.  Minimal handling. This is the closest they say to a “natural wine”. The grapes are destemmed then spend 12 days on the skin fermenting.  The wine is racked but not filtered before bottling. This wine has a nice medium orange plus peach colour. Medium-intensity orange aromas. Medium body, dry with a lean mouthfeel. This wine does get rounder with swirling in the glass. Oranges and a touch of tannins on the palate. Fresh fruit flavour with tannic structure. 4.5 stars

Southbrook Vineyards Small Lot Skin Ferment Vidal 2020 – this wine is organic and biodynamic. 30% of the grapes were foot tread then all were whole-cluster fermented.  It spends more time on skins than the Triomphe.  Racked and bottled unfiltered.  It has a deeper orange colour. Light nutty nose with a hint of stone fruit. Medium-plus body with higher acidity. Cider-like flavour plus citrus. A wine with a textured mouthfeel. Medium tannins. Medium-plus length with tart fruit and medium tannic finish. More texture than specific fruit flavours. A geeky wine. 4.5 stars

Southbrook Saunders Family Vineyard Merlot 2020 –  18 months of aging in French oak barrels, 30% new.  Through the aging process, Casey tastes the wine from each barrel and selects only the best barrels for this wine and their Cabernet Franc.  Only two barrels were selected for the Merlot and four barrels for the Cabernet Franc in 2020.  The rest of the wines are declassified into their Triomphe series.  This wine has a dull medium-intensity garnet colour. A light berry nose. Dry, light body with a soft, lightly round mouthfeel. Ripe berry fruit, plus touches of oak, vanilla, red cherries, red apples, and plums. Medium-intensity soft tannins. Medium plus length with a light peppery finish. Nice fruit flavours. 4.5 stars

Southbrook Vineyards Saunders Family Vineyard Cabernet Franc 2020 – Medium intensity dull garnet. Light aromas of red apples, red fruit, red plums and a touch of chocolate and tomato. Dry, medium body with a semi-round mouthfeel. Ripe plums, candied red cherries, tart red fruit and some chocolate flavours. Medium-plus length. Medium-intensity drying tannins and tartness on the finish. 4 stars4.5 stars

Southbrook Vineyards Estate Cabernet Sauvignon 2020 – organic and biodynamic. This wine after a wild fermentation spent 18 months in oak, 50% new barrels.  It has a deeper garnet colour. Nice light aromas of red fruit, red cherries and a touch of oak. Medium plus body, with a round thicker mouthfeel. Very fruity red cherry and tart red fruit flavours. Higher acidity. A lighter mouthfeel. Light to medium tannins. Medium-plus length finishing with tart red fruit flavours. 4.5 stars

Southbrook Vineyards Poetica 2020 – their flagship wine that is organic and biodynamic.  Not made every year.  It has to be an exceptional vintage. This vintage is 60% Cabernet Sauvignon with 30% Merlot, 5% Petit Verdot, and 5% Cabernet Franc. Whole berries were fermented in micro-cuvee lots in open-top new French oak barrels.  Post-pressing, these lots were returned to barrels for 18 months of aging, then tasted, assessed and blended.  The blend was returned to oak barrels, 30% new, for another 5 months of aging.  This wine has a deeper dull garnet colour. Light aromas of dark fruit and sweet spices. Dry, medium-plus body with higher acidity. Red and black fruit, plums, red cherries and chocolate on the palate. Medium tannins. Medium length finishing with lightly drying tannins and pepperiness. 4.5 stars
